Electrical Maintenance Engineer



Salary: 42,000

Hours: 8am-5pm (1 hour lunch paid)

**Must have an electrical qualification**



Benefits:

  • Pension
  • Overtime
  • Flexibility
  • 25 days plus bank holidays


Duties:

  • Daily preventative maintenance activities and routine safety inspections.
  • Fault finding and diagnostics in reactive breakdown or planned situations.
  • Planned preventative maintenance on a variety of production machinery to include extruders and site services.
  • Ensure all breakdowns are dealt with promptly and efficiently whilst ensuring that all PPM schedules are maintained.
  • Respond promptly to any unplanned maintenance issues or repairs to ensure minimum down time
  • Demonstrate tenacity in approach to incident management and actively pursue investigations to identify root causes


Experience required:

  • Flexible, highly motivated and driven with the ability to prioritise own workload, possess strong intellect, good logical fault finding analysis capabilities and who can demonstrate the ability to make decisions and empower people to drive actions forward. Results orientated, with ability to deliver results in a rapidly changing environment. Excellent attention to detail.
  • Will have a time served apprenticeship (or equivalent) and have a recognised qualification in a related discipline (or equivalent)
  • Possess excellent communication, organisational and interpersonal skills and be a confident team player.
  • Experience of working in a production maintenance environment is essential for this role.
Qualifications needed:

  • Recognised Electrical Engineering qualification.
  • NVQ or HNC / Degree level qualification in an Engineering discipline.
  • 18th Edition BS7671
